From our team to yours — practical tips to keep your home or business safe, efficient, and up to code.
Press the test button on your RCDs regularly. If they don't trip and reset, call us immediately — they may be faulty.
Flickering or dimming lights can indicate loose wiring, overloaded circuits, or failing connections — all fire hazards if left unchecked.
Heat or buzzing from an outlet means arcing or loose wiring. Switch it off and call us immediately — don't ignore it.
Especially in older homes. Plugging too many devices into one board causes overheating and is a leading cause of house fires in WA.
WA legislation requires working smoke alarms in all homes. We install and test them to ensure full compliance and your family's safety.
Never store items in front of your switchboard. In an emergency, you need to reach it fast to cut power to your home.
LEDs use up to 75% less energy than halogen downlights. A full home LED upgrade can save hundreds of dollars per year on power bills.

If your breaker trips repeatedly, you have an overloaded circuit or a faulty appliance. Don't just keep resetting it — call us to find the cause.
A burning or plastic smell near power points means wiring is overheating. Turn off the circuit at the switchboard and call us immediately.
This suggests your home's wiring can't handle the load. It's a sign of an undersized circuit or ageing wiring that needs upgrading.
Ceramic fuses are dangerous and outdated. They don't protect against modern electrical loads. A switchboard upgrade is essential.
Any tingling or shock from switches, appliances or taps is a serious warning sign. Call us — this can be life-threatening if ignored.
After a leak or flood, don't use affected power points or switches. Call us before restoring power to affected areas.
Replacing a globe or LED bulb is fine. But replacing a light fitting or any work inside the ceiling requires a licensed electrician.
Installing or moving power points must be done by a licensed electrician in WA. Illegal DIY electrical work voids your home insurance.
Under WA law, all electrical work (except changing bulbs) must be performed by a licensed electrician. Penalties include heavy fines.
Using extension cords as a permanent solution is dangerous. If you need more power points, have them properly installed.
Ceiling fans connect to your home's wiring. Installation must be done by a licensed electrician to ensure safe and compliant wiring.

All outdoor power points in WA must have weatherproof covers rated for external use. Standard indoor covers will fail.
Storm water can enter roof cavities and damage wiring. If lights flicker or RCDs trip after rain, have your wiring inspected.
WA summer storms cause power surges that can destroy appliances and damage wiring. Whole-home surge protection is affordable.
Standard cable degrades rapidly in WA's harsh sun. All outdoor cabling we install is UV-rated for longevity.
Farm sheds, irrigation pumps, and bore equipment take a beating in WA conditions. Annual electrical inspections prevent costly failures.
Pool and spa electrical work has strict safety requirements in WA. Always use a licensed electrician.
